Student education loans run being an installment loan, like an automobile loan or home loan. The borrower pays back a principal amount borrowed, usually with interest (that’s the rate you are charged to borrow the funds), over a certain time period with an installment loan. When an installment loan is reduced, the account is closed – contrasted to revolving credit accounts, like bank card reports, which often stay available for future usage.
